Did you know that the adult human body is 60 percent water? Our lungs consist of a staggering 83 percent water, and even our bones seem watery at 31 percent.  Unsurprisingly, staying hydrated plays a vital role in our health and allows the body to carry out its many processes. But what makes hydration so important, and how can we start drinking more water right away? Let’s discuss.
